                                  zbrown;306953 wrote:
                                  I am going to sound like a complete newb but is that a belt drive distributor or what?

                                  Yep, ricers use belt drive distributors.

                                  🙂

                                  DaveH
                                  '94 Supra- 7.77 @ 176mph

                                  legacy image

                                  1 Reply Last reply
                                  0
                                  • 63vette6 Offline
                                    63vette6 Offline
                                    63vette
                                    wrote on last edited by
                                    #19

                                    DaveH;306971 wrote:
                                    Yep, ricers use belt drive distributors.

                                    🙂

                                    Ouch! You should talk Dave!

                                    Belt drive distributor and cam drive. No harmonics and more precise timing control. Distributor stays cooler and doesn't put torsional loading on the cam. Motor is a sbc 434 and made 832hp at 7200 no spray. E98.
